Walgreens, AzPC Team Up for Population Health Management - Analyst Blog

Leading drug retailer Walgreen Co. WAG has entered into a clinical care collaboration agreement with Arizona Priority Care (AzPC) for the purpose of population health management. Per the deal, Walgreens and AzPC pharmacists and practitioners will jointly work toward the improvement of patient care and quality outcomes.

These services will be provided to AzPC Medicare Advantage and ACO members through select Walgreens pharmacies and Healthcare Clinics. According to Walgreens, this program will not only open up access to a bunch of health care services at its select outlets, but will also help reduce overall healthcare costs.

Walgreens and AzPC have teamed up to bring forth a comprehensive range of clinical and preventive health services that will extend clinicians' efforts of providing high-quality population health services backed by the extensive network of Walgreens pharmacy and medication management services.

Some of the collaborative services offered to AzPC members will include medication management schemes like medication therapy management and adherence programs; health risk assessments and health testing including cholesterol and blood pressure; immunizations and patient education and wellness services.

In order to stimulate customer demand amid a challenging macroeconomic scenario, Walgreens has been undertaking a number of strategic steps. These include consistent new alignments. Earlier this month, the company, along with Greater Than AIDS, formed a coalition with health departments and local AIDS service organizations across the country to encourage community members to offer HIV testing.

In Mar 2014, Walgreens tied up with Lebhar-Friedman Publishing to launch Discover Beauty Within, the first exclusive beauty publication for mass retailers. The publication is focused on providing Walgreens and Duane Reade store customers with timely editorial content and valuable coupons on behalf of the retailers' merchandising partners. Prior to that, in Jan 2014, Walgreens had entered into a clinical collaboration agreement with Centura Health, a leading health care network in the U.S. to provide easier and wider access to healthcare services.

With the Affordable Care Act bringing millions of newly insured patients into the health care system, such relationships aim to help address some of the needs and challenges faced by both patients and caregivers.
